First look at Tom Hardy from the set of Tinker, Tailor, Solider, Spy



One of the films that’s already being highly anticipated for next year is director Tomas Alfredson’s TINKER, TAILOR, SOLDIER, SPY. As we all know by now, the adaptation of the John le Carré spy novel boasts one of the best casts of any of 2011’s upcoming films: Gary Oldman, Colin Firth, Tom Hardy, Benedict Cumberbatch, Ciaran Hinds, Mark Strong, Svetlana Khodchenkova, Toby Jones, John Hurt, Stephen Graham, and Kathy Burke.

Hardy (THE DARK KNIGHT RISES, INCEPTION), who came aboard replacing the previously attached Michael Fassbender, has been revealed for the first time on set. He plays British agent ‘Ricki Tarr’, seen here sporting a mean wig.

From our last update:

The story – at one point adapted by Peter Morgan with John Le Carré, though now being credited to Bridget O’Connor (SIXTY SIX) and Peter Straughan (THE MEN WHO STARE AT GOATS) who were presumably brought on at some point to do a rewrite – follows retired intelligence agent George Smiley (Oldman) who’s called back to service when a high-ranking member of MI6 is suspected of being a Soviet mole. The film is based on Le Carré’s first novel of The Karla Trilogy.

TINKER, TAILOR, SOLDIER, SPY is currently filming and is due out next year.
